我正在尝试定义任何简单的函数来跨越ghci中的多行,请以以下示例为例:
let abs n | n >= 0 = n
| otherwise = -n
到目前为止,我已经尝试在第一行之后按Enter键:
Prelude> let abs n | n >= 0 = n
Prelude> | otherwise = -n
<interactive>:1:0: parse error on input `|'
我也尝试过使用:{and :}命令,但距离并不远:
Prelude> :{
unknown command ':{'
use :? for help.
我在Linux上使用适用于Haskell 98的GHC Interactive 6.6版,我缺少什么?
aluckdog
DIEA
精慕HU